In what was no doubt a rare moment for all involved, Huffington Post editorial director Howard Fineman noted on MSNBCs Hardball w/ Chris Matthews that Harvard Law School professors were in awe of Texas Republican Senator and presidential candidate Ted Cruzs intellect.
At Harvard Law School, he was the professors were in awe of his intellect, Fineman noted. Even if they disagreed with him, which they did vehemently, these people knew that this guy was trained under the Federalist Society second-generation Republican wave. In other words, not the Reagan years, but these years.
The rare complement from the dedicated liberal came in the midst of a fourteen-minute Cruz bashfest led by host Chris Matthews. Fineman himself wrote an editorial earlier in the day mocking Cruz as anti-abortion, a global-warming mega-skeptic, to the right of Likud on Israel, [and] anti-immigration to the max
